Internal Memo — Training Budget, Next Year

Finance team: heads up that the proposed training budget is coming in about 22% above this year. Before anyone winces, most of the increase is the certification push for the Merrow rollout — it's mandatory, not nice-to-have. The rest covers leadership coaching and the usual conference allocation, which we've actually trimmed. I'd like provisional sign-off by month end so HR can book vendors early and lock better rates. The confidential note below explains the plans driving the Merrow spend.

board note of tawig-bajof: The renewal with Ralixix Holdings closes at $10 million a year, 20 percent above the last contract. Project Druix slips by two quarters because of the tooling delay.

FareLattice Rules Engine — plugin release steps. Before publishing, validate your shipping-fee rule bundle against the v9 schema using the bundled linter, and confirm zone tables resolve for all Merrowgate test regions. Increment the manifest version, regenerate the checksum file, and attach release notes describing any fee-calculation changes. All plugin archives must be signed prior to upload; use the key that follows.

release key, hadug-kawef: bky13_mPGeFZeR1GZ1G

Alert: thumbcache-rss-growth. The Orvane image cache leaks roughly 40MB/hour under sustained thumbnail churn; RSS crosses the 6GB alert threshold after ~3 days of uptime. Suspected cause: evicted entries retaining decoded bitmap references. Workaround is a rolling restart every 48h, automated since Tuesday. Fix is in review; target is next week's release train. Triage notes and heap snapshots are collected on the internal page linked below.

wiki page, tahaf-tajog: https://jira.ordindyn.corp/pipeline